LG Display to shift $1.4B from iPad Pro to iPhone screen production due to iPad's poor sales.

LG Display plans to shift production from iPad Pro OLED screens to iPhone screens due to lower-than-expected sales of the latest iPad Pro. This move, estimated to cost $1.4 billion, will increase iPhone screen production by 15,000 units per month. The change reflects the iPad Pro's underperformance and requires Apple's approval due to differences in manufacturing processes for iPhone and iPad Pro screens.
